Riveter Rose vs Purbeck Stone
Where Riveter Rose belongs to PPG's range, Purbeck Stone is a Farrow & Ball color. Purbeck Stone (LRV 52) reflects noticeably more light than Riveter Rose (LRV 41), a difference of 11 points that becomes especially apparent in rooms with limited natural light. The ΔE 7.8 gap is real but not dramatic — close enough to use together, distinct enough to matter as a choice.
